Output 161867915c3f159c4e9d640d8b2f6cb6662ef1d1fbf5cab6c9bb03a08b6ea296:0

value
19700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ace958508ca15d31c2a1f14b78c9e30d9dfc942 OP_EQUALVERIFY OP_CHECKSIG
address
14uLrmcD4V5tDW8KoL19bdvbU4WqBBnES1
transaction
161867915c3f159c4e9d640d8b2f6cb6662ef1d1fbf5cab6c9bb03a08b6ea296
spent
true